Celtic fans are facing yet another merchandise release this summer as details of a new pre-match kit were published by Footy Headlines.

The leaked shirt features a dark green base with a dense geometric pattern running across the front and sleeves.

Adidas have placed both its logo and the Celtic badge centrally on the chest in a light beige colour, while the sleeves include a stylised ‘CELTIC’ graphic that continues the current abstract design theme.
